What does the law number eight of Hammurabi‘s code describe the punishment for

Respuesta :

madisont1127 madisont1127
  • 03-10-2020

Answer:

. If any one steal cattle or sheep,or a pig or a goat, if it belong to a god or to the court, the thief shall pay thirtyfold therefor; if they belonged to a freed man of the king he shall pay tenfold; if the thief has nothing with which to pay he shall be put to death.
